Output 32d17c396ede394d345604f36985ea610c55f55985a2a6c214a6c8d2b4d20630:9

value
13790000
script pubkey
OP_0 OP_PUSHBYTES_20 e3f0406ac6b494f86f085ffb0a8ae5c9fb627246
address
ltc1qu0cyq6kxkj20smcgtlas4zh9e8akyujx8qxhma
transaction
32d17c396ede394d345604f36985ea610c55f55985a2a6c214a6c8d2b4d20630
spent
true